Mnemonics can be helpful in UCAT Abstract Reasoning to prevent you from missing common patterns. During the 1 minute instruction time prior to the start of the UCAT Abstract Reasoning subtest, you can quickly note down your mnemonic on your noteboard so you can refer to it during the test. Abstract Reasoning – timing tips. The UCAT Abstract Reasoning part is the quickest – only 12 minutes – but it also features the most questions – a staggering 50. You must be aware of how much time (or rather, how little!) you have for each question and that you keep track of it. On exam day, especially if you have not extensively .Abstract Reasoning is the most time-pressured subtest in the UCAT. Although it is the shortest section, it also has the most questions - you have to answer 50 questions in 12 minutes! So, you get an average of 14 seconds per question.You should spend most of your time analysing the pattern- this will help you arrive to the correct answer faster.
